EDITORS COMMENTS
In this print from Memory Lane Prints, we are transported back to the 1997 general election as the Labour Party launches their highly anticipated manifesto. The image captures a pivotal moment in British political history, showcasing key figures who would shape the nation's future. At the forefront stands Tony Blair, exuding confidence and determination as he addresses the crowd. With his charismatic presence and visionary ideas, Blair would soon become one of Britain's most influential Prime Ministers. Standing beside him is John Prescott, a trusted ally known for his passionate advocacy of working-class interests. Behind them stand three prominent Labour politicians: Gordon Brown, Margaret Beckett, and Frank Dobson. Each figure represents a different aspect of Labour's broad appeal - Brown with his economic expertise, Beckett with her experience in foreign affairs, and Dobson with his dedication to healthcare reform. This photograph encapsulates not only an election launch but also an era marked by hope and anticipation for change. It symbolizes a united front ready to tackle pressing issues such as education reform, healthcare improvements, and social justice.
